Charlcoal Smokes
This was my first "smokey" shadow quad I purchased. The colors are all shimmery except for the black which has actual micro-glitters. I love how the packaging looks and that it has directions for how to create a perfect smokey eye. You get a nice amount of product for the price and you can make so many different looks with these colors. The shadows are pigmented and last a long time especially when combined with a primer. Even if I use a different silver or gray I ALWAYS use the black that comes in this quad. It is simply perfect for lining your eyes [try it wet, it is AWESOME!]. The applicators suck but who uses those any way? — 2 years, 5 months agoThis review is: Helpful | Not helpful | Inappropriate | 4 of 6 people said helpful

Smoky Eye Heaven...
I've been using this shadow FOR YEARS. I'm currently using "Stylish Smokes" and use three of the colors in the package. There's always one color out of the four that is really sparkly and shimmery, which I don't use, so it goes to waste. But other than that, I love these shadows. The color payoff is HUGE ~ deep, dark and beautiful color, smooth application and excellent blendability. I prefer to use the sponge-tip applicators that come with it....they seem to deliver more color per application. I blend with a brush afterwards. I've tried using a brush to apply, but the color goes on too weak. As a fan of a darker smoky eye that is easy and simple, Maybelline New York shadows win every time. — 2 years, 3 months agoThis review is: Helpful | Not helpful | Inappropriate | 9 of 11 people said helpful

Pair with a primer
These shadows are actually pretty awesome. Used dry, they do a decent job with coverage & lasting. I definitely prefer applying them damp for better color payoff & longevity. You can use it dry with great results if you use a primer. It will last you all day without creasing if used with a good primer. Maybelline also offers a pretty good range of colors to create tons of different looks; it own the brownish/ bronze-y quad shown & another purple smokey-eye quad and both work really well. The powder is not chalky or cheap feeling and you don't need to layer a ton on to achieve good results. — 2 years agoThis review is: Helpful | Not helpful | Inappropriate | 2 of 2 people said helpful
